messages

An API for Chrome Extension messages that makes sense.

MIT License

Downloads
1.5K
Stars
75
Committers
3

Bot releases are hidden (Show)

messages - Fixing peer deps Latest Release

Published by jacksteamdev over 3 years ago

Now this package will support either rxjs@^6 or rxjs@^7, which ever you have installed. If you don't have rxjs installed, it will use v7.

messages - Fixing peer deps

Published by jacksteamdev over 3 years ago

messages - Supporting RxJS 7

Published by jacksteamdev over 3 years ago

  • chore: upgrade jest 💩 32aae34
  • chore: upgrade rxjs and switch to peerDep tests: upgrade typescript and ts-jest a8d0498

https://github.com/extend-chrome/messages/compare/v1.2.0...v1.2.1

messages - Supporting iframe specific messages

Published by jacksteamdev almost 4 years ago

Now you can send a message to a single iframe!

messages.send(message, { tabId, frameId })
  • Merge pull request #2 from extend-chrome/beta 5247425
  • [tests] update tests for frameId daffa03

https://github.com/extend-chrome/messages/compare/v1.2.0-0...v1.2.0

messages - Beta Release - Supporting frameId

Published by jacksteamdev almost 4 years ago

This beta release adds support for sending a message to a specific frame in a tab.

  • [chore] upgrade dependencies c6f90ad
  • [feat] support frameIds a57b3d8

https://github.com/extend-chrome/messages/compare/v1.1.2...v1.2.0-0

messages - Migrating to @extend-chrome

Published by jacksteamdev over 4 years ago

This release marks our transition to the new organization @extend-chrome

  • Update package json 1444349
  • Fix npm scripts 8274e56
  • Re install rollup plugin sucrase for e2e testing ba4e6e6
  • 1.1.1 e4b2b3b
  • Update the readme logo 9f913cd
  • Remove unused dependencies afb78f2
  • Convert to extend-chrome 97fccb0
  • Update configs 55d9125
  • Clean up imports 75089e9
  • Add jest mock file 565d1b6

https://github.com/extend-chrome/messages/compare/v1.1.0...v1.1.2

messages - v1.1.0

Published by jacksteamdev over 4 years ago

Minor updates to README and dependencies

  • Ignore todo 88a3378
  • Update rollup config Fix tsconfig for rollup plugin b4457e1
  • Fix build step for tests Remove unneccessary test 8516293
  • Sort package json 932cc46
  • Clean up test file 40b8aa0
  • Merge branch 'master' of github.com:bumble-org/messages 2ba17ea
  • Update readme and remove warning c4f4963
  • Update readme 6b4c854
  • Update config 80739fa
  • Add warning to README d2e3de3

https://github.com/bumble-org/messages/compare/v1.0.0...v1.1.0

messages - First Major Version

Published by jacksteamdev over 4 years ago

This release features some major changes including:

[REMOVED]

  • Named pages have been completely removed

[CHANGED]

  • send now uses a second argument with a property called tabId to send a message to a tab (this was previously target)
  • useLine was renamed to getMessage

[ADDED]

  • getMessage returns a tuple with three elements: a message sender, a message Observable, and a waitFor function that resolves on the first message received.